What I Check Before Buying
Before I choose one, I always compare a few important features. I want the truck to match the kind of work I do, the weight I carry, and the type of stairs I face most often.
Weight Capacity
I first check how much weight the hand truck can safely carry. If I plan to move appliances, stacked boxes, or construction materials, I make sure the capacity is higher than my typical load. I prefer some extra margin so I’m not pushing the machine to its limit.
Stair-Climbing Ability
Not every electric hand truck handles stairs the same way. I look for models designed specifically for stair climbing, with track systems, powered wheels, or assisted lifting features. If I deal with narrow or steep stairs, this becomes one of my top priorities.
Battery Life
Since it’s electric, battery performance matters a lot to me. I check how long it runs on a full charge and whether the battery can handle several trips in one day. If I use it often, I want a model with fast charging or a spare battery option.
Build Quality
I pay close attention to the frame material, wheel durability, and overall construction. A sturdy aluminum or steel frame usually gives me more confidence when moving heavy loads. I also look for reinforced joints and stable handles because I want something that feels reliable.
Ease of Use
I prefer a model that is simple to operate, even when I’m tired or in a hurry. Intuitive controls, smooth balance, and easy loading make a big difference. If I have to fight with the machine, it defeats the purpose.
Portability and Storage
I think about where I’ll keep it when I’m not using it. If I have limited space, I look for a foldable design or a compact frame. A lighter unit is also easier for me to transport in a truck or van.
Safety Features I Look For
Safety matters just as much as performance. I always want features that help prevent accidents and protect both me and the load.
Anti-Slip Handles
I like handles with a firm, comfortable grip so I can keep control even if my hands are sweaty or wet.
Brake System
A good braking system gives me more confidence on stairs and ramps. I want the truck to stay steady when I pause or reposition it.
Load Stability
I look for straps, secure platforms, or support arms that help keep items from shifting while I move them.
Low Center of Gravity
A stable design helps me feel safer, especially when I’m carrying awkward or top-heavy items.
Types of Electric Hand Trucks I Compare
I usually see a few different styles, and each one fits a different kind of job.
Track Stair Climbers
These are the ones I consider when I need the most stair support. The track system helps distribute weight and improves traction on steps.
Powered Wheel Models
I like these for lighter stair work or mixed surfaces. They often feel easier to maneuver and may be more compact.
Convertible Models
Some hand trucks can switch between regular dolly use and stair-climbing support. I find these useful if I need one tool for multiple tasks.
